Solving Drainage Issues in Charlotte Piedmont Lawns

Persistent lawn drainage problems plague many Charlotte properties because heavy clay soils naturally restrict water movement. Standing water after rainfall creates anaerobic conditions favoring disease, preventing root growth, and creating safety hazards. In the Piedmont region, successful drainage solutions combine surface grading, subsurface improvements, and plant selection to move water away from structures and usable yard space. Identifying drainage problems and implementing appropriate solutions prevents costly property damage and maintains lawn health.

Drainage Solution Strategy

  1. Surface grading: Establish minimum 2% slope directing water away from structures and low areas
  2. French drains: Install perforated drainage lines in low areas with surrounding rock and filter fabric
  3. Catch basins: Position drainage collection areas at natural low points with surface inlets
  4. Swales: Create shallow channels with gentle slopes directing water toward drain areas
  5. Soil amendment: Add compost and organic matter improving drainage in heavy clay soils
  6. Core aeration: Relieve soil compaction that restricts water infiltration and root penetration
  7. Plant selection: Choose water-tolerant species for persistently moist areas
Pro Tip: In Charlotte's clay-based Piedmont soils, surface drainage improvements combined with aeration solve most residential drainage problems without expensive subsurface drainage installation. Strategic grading redirects water more effectively than attempting to fix drainage through soil amendment alone.
